Efficient but not crazy loud exhaust - ls3

Hey all. Just bought my first Camaro SS with the ls3. I'd like to open up the exhaust with 3" pipes to let more air run through for some power and better mpgs but I don't want to wake the dead when I'm driving down the road or attract any unwanted legal presences. Not very familiar with what's out there. Anyone have any suggestions?

3" is not going to open anything up for more power. In fact you'll see very little if any power gains on a cat back exhaust system.
Headers + tune will add power but also will increase the noise level quite a bit.
Corsa is a great one for keeping things tame (no drone at any level) and excellent for cruising without waking the dead.

Once you start modding further with headers and cam that's when things start to get loud.

I have Corsa and it is obnoxiously loud but no drone. Installed the stock resonators back into the pipes to help and it almost did nothing. I have ordered the Flowmaster Force 2 axle backs to see if that will help. If I have to I will install some mini bullets just in front of the mufflers. I also have some 200 cell cats to install in the spring. I'll get this thing under control somehow. Corsa was good until I did the engine work, installed headers and removed the cats, all at the same time.

If you're looking for more performance and a nice tame exhaust note long tube headers, high flow cats, and an x-pipe sounds really nice through the stock exhaust on an LS3. It's very calm until you really dig into it, and then it has a pretty nice wail to it. Cat-back won't gain you any power, but long tubes and high flow cats definitely will.
